by G. L. Penney The county now seems to be proceeding with plans to modify the county office building even though the legislature has yet to adopt any specific plan. At the last work session, we approved the expenditure of $5,000 for an engineering study of the area below the stage in the Hubbard auditorium. I should have known better. A building designed to hold hundreds of active children out to be able to accommodate any normal use. The only heavier use that I can think of has in fact begun, namely, the storage of old paper records. This is happening at a time when the state government is proceeding with plans to store all records electronically. My concern is that the county building will end up full of trash. I remember when the county spent $126,000 to have someone take such a building off our hands so that we could build a new one. Even now, the first thing one sees upon entering the county building is a stairwell barricaded with plastic. Some time ago I had remarked to the chairman of the legislature that this ought to have been corrected. I was told that we needed a building plan. So, I typed up a preliminary plan and gave it to the chairman expecting him to schedule a discussion. He has not done so.
